Property Overview: 111 Martin Avenue W, Glenelm, Winnipeg
Section 1: Key Characteristics & Appeal
This one-and-three-quarter storey home, built in 1936, presents a classic Glenelm character home with practical updates. Its key feature is a recently renovated basement, adding valuable finished living space to the 800 sqft main footprint. The property includes a detached garage and sits on a 2,699 sqft lot.
The appeal lies in its position as a well-priced entry point into a mature, established neighbourhood. The home's assessed value ranks above average for its immediate street, suggesting it is viewed favorably within its local context. It suits first-time homebuyers, downsizers, or investors looking for a character home with some modern practicality (the renovated basement) without a premium price tag. It’s a "right-sized" property for those who value location and community over sheer square footage, offering a manageable footprint and yard.
A less obvious perspective is the potential for value stability. While smaller than area averages, its above-street-average assessment indicates it may hold its value well within the micro-market of Martin Avenue W, which can be a buffer against broader market fluctuations.
Section 2: Frequently Asked Questions
1. How does the living space compare to nearby homes?
At 800 sqft, the living area is below the average for both the Glenelm neighbourhood and Winnipeg overall. However, it is closer to the average for homes on Martin Avenue W itself. The renovated basement provides additional functional space.
2. What does the assessed value tell us?
The assessed value of $24,800 is notably above the street average, which often indicates the property has features or conditions that the assessor views favorably compared to its direct neighbours, such as its renovated basement.
3. Is the lot size typical for the area?
The 2,699 sqft lot is slightly below the average for Martin Avenue W and more notably below the averages for Glenelm and the city. This is common for older, central neighbourhoods and results in a lower-maintenance yard.
4. What can recent sale history indicate?
The home sold in July 2021 for an estimated $22,500-$25,500. This historical price aligns closely with its current assessed value, suggesting a stable valuation in recent years.
5. Who might this property not suit?
Buyers needing significant space, a modern open-concept layout, or a large private yard may find this home limiting. It is best suited for those comfortable with the layout of a classic, compact character home.
